Remove the Adapter
The following describes how to remove the adapter.
1. Disconnect the communications cables from the E4SA.
2. Put on your electrostatic discharge (ESD) wriststrap and connect the grounding clip
securely to an exposed, unpainted, metal surface on the service side of the system
enclosure, such as the processor multifunction (PMF) CRU or I/O multifunction
(IOMF) CRU ventilation holes
The figure shows how to connect the grounding clip to the ventilation holes on the
PMF or IOMF CRU.
3. Unlatch the ejector on the E4SA by pressing the blue-green tab on the ejector and
pulling the ejector outward to unseat the E4SA from the backplane.
4. Grasp the E4SA by its ejector in one hand and slowly pull the E4SA out of the slot
while supporting the bottom edge of the E4SA with the other hand.
